rfid技术的考勤系统【字数:12016】

摘 要此次课题的目标是设计一个学生进行考勤打卡,以及学校老师对考勤情况的查询和管理的软硬件结合的项目。学生考勤系统采用基于RFID技术的身份识别技术来实现,主要包括上位机模块和下位机模块两大部分。其中,下位机模块选择了51单片机中的STC89C52芯片,通过读写设备采集IC卡数据并解码,接着通过串口通信模块把数据上传至上位机部分,进行考勤结果的记录和管理。上位机模块主要基于VS软件设计客户端界面,结合SQLite数据库,来进行考勤数据的查询和管理。 本系统项目的主要步骤1.研究学生考勤的现状2.分析学生考勤系统设计所需的软硬件要求,建立一个基础的模型框架结构,列出该系统所需要达成的功能,进行系统硬件芯片的选择,以及软件开发设计所需要的技术支撑。3.建立数据库模型,录入学生IC卡信息。4.基于VS设计上位机客户端界面,显示考勤结果,便于学校老师的查询和管理。这个系统利用RFID技术来关注学生的出勤率,这减少了现有的手动考勤带来的麻烦,提高了效率,也有助于学校老师对学生的学习情况的掌握与管理。
目 录
1. 引言 1
1.1 RFID技术在国内外研究的现状与发展前景 1
1.1.1 国内外研究现状 1
1.1.2 发展趋势 1
1.2 基于RFID考勤系统课题研究的目的和意义 2
1.3 本课题解决思路或实验方法 2
2. 系统开发对社会的影响 4
3. 项目开发环境及技术需求介绍 5
3.1 开发环境 5
3.1.1 SQLite数据库 5
3.1.2 Keil 5开发平台 6
3.1.3 Visual Studio 6
3.2 开发技术 6
3.2.1 C#语言 6
3.2.2 RFID技术 7
4.系统设计 9
4.1 硬件设计 9
4.1.1 51单片机 9
4.1.2 电源电路模块 10
4.1.3 LCD12864液晶屏模块 10
4.1.4 射频识别模块 11
4.1.5 按键模块 12
4.1.6  *好棒文|www.hbsrm.com +Q: ^351916072* 
复位按键模块 12
4.2 软件设计 12
4.3 串口通信设计 13
5.数据库设计 14
5.1 实体属性说明 14
5.2 数据库建立 14
5.2.1 学生信息表——Data 14
5.2.2 数据库表的建立 15
6. 系统实现 16
6.1 考勤系统总结构 16
6.2 硬件实现 16
6.2.1 初始功能 17
6.2.2 开始打卡界面 18
6.2.3 打卡信息显示功能 19
6.2.4 结束打卡结果显示功能 20
6.3 软件实现 22
6.3.1 系统时间部分的实现 22
6.3.2 端口设置部分的实现 23
6.3.3 实时数据部分的实现 23
6.3.4 数据查询部分的实现 24
6.4 串口通信实现 26
7.系统测试 28
结 语 29
参考文献 30
致 谢 31
1. 引言
1.1 RFID技术在国内外研究的现状与发展前景
1.1.1 国内外研究现状
射频识别( Radio Frequency Identification)是一种早期出现的开发技术。在20世纪中叶,RFID技术在理论上得到了发展并进行了一些初步测试。人们利用这项技术进行一些应用,从而推动RFID技术的发展进入了一个快速的时代。进入二十一世纪阶段,RFID技术越来越受到人们的重视。RFID技术产品种类越来越多,这表明RFID技术目前已在现实生活中得到广泛应用。伴随着科学技术的不断进步,RFID技术将变得愈来愈越成熟,应用领域也在一步一步地拓宽广泛,具有广阔的应用前景。
从国外来看,RFID技术的进步的速度是迅猛的,产品种类多种多样。在全球,美国为推动RFID技术发展与进步做出了很大的贡献,所以美国在RFID的标准、相关的软硬件技术、以及研究应用领域方面,位于世界的前列。最近几年开始,随着美国和欧洲许多企业的推动,RFID技术的应用范围在不断扩大,涉到智能物流、食品溯源、金融支付、电子商务、交通管理,以及农业管理等等各个方面。今天,在美国,英国,德国,日本和瑞士,已经生产出更成熟的先进RFID技术产品。
而在中国国内,与众多的欧美国家相比,我国RFID技术的发展是处于比较落后的阶段。中国RFID技术的发展缺乏核心和关键技术。虽然,在中国,低频RFID技术已经进入成熟发展阶段,应用范围也很广泛,但对超高频RFID技术的研究与国外比较成熟的技术相比,还是在一定程度上有差异。在我国,RFID技术的发展还是十分迅速的,已经在身份证、公共交通、智能物流以及食品溯源方面得到了推广,在未来它将会在更多的领域发挥出更大的作用。
1.1.2 发展趋势
RFID因为具有快速识别、安全性高以及存储容量大的特点,成为了物品追踪的主要技术,所以RFID技术会成为新兴产业——物联网发展的支撑性技术中的一员。物联网是建立在互联网的基础上,增加了传感器设备,目标在于利用射频识别技术、无线通信技术,实现物与物相联系。物联网时代,是继在互联网革命之后的新的一次信息技术的突破与创新。而,RFID技术作为支撑性的技术之一,它的发展肯定会推进物联网的发展。
随着科学的发展,信息技术的不断进步,对RFID应用的需求也越来越大,这将会促进RFID向更先进的方向发展。RFID标签的功能会增加,RFID硬件模块也会变得更加小巧、便携。总之,在我国,RFID技术的发展前景还是十分豁亮的。
1.2 基于RFID考勤系统课题研究的目的和意义
在中国,学生数量是非常多的,从小学到初中,到高中,再到大学,数量众多的学生就会给学校老师的管理上带来许多困难,考勤问题就会成为学生管理上的重大问题。由于学生数量的庞大,传统的考勤(就像点名或签名式签到)已经难以满足学校的要求了。传统的签到方式不但浪费时间,还会花费老师学校的心思,增加老师的负担;对学生来讲,不仅同时也消耗学生的上课时间,降低了学生上课的效率,还每每会出现漏签,代签等等众多问题。所以,传统的考勤管理主要还是取决于学生的自觉性。一旦,学生不能够自觉,那这种点名方式是没有效果的。而且,在老师管理方面,由于信息量庞大,工作难度也是比较大的。因此,建立智能化的考勤管理制度,是中国学校信息化管理的重要一步。

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/wlw/205.html

好棒文